The instructions I received for my Carafate was four times a day - no drinking/eating for one hour before taking it and for one hour after taking it. I only had to take it for the first two weeks after surgery. I had to set an alarm early in the morning (like five am or something like that) to start on my schedule in order to get all of my water, carafate, food, and vitamins in. It may have been easier for me though because my plan didnt involve use of any snacks / protein shakes. I was only having to juggle it inbetween three meals a day, my water, and vitamins.
